EXTRA CREDIT
Ephrem Shaffer, of Staples-Motley High School received the Wells Fargo Spotlight On The Arts Award of Excellence at the 2007 state high school speech tournament. The award program is part of the Spotlight on the Arts campaign, a program established by Wells Fargo and the Minnesota State High School League to increase awareness for high school fine arts activities including debate, one-act play and speech.

This was Brainerd
MAY 7 - 60 years ago (1947) - With a heavy frost covering the ground in Brainerd early this morning and with temperatures which dropped from 51 degrees to 23 degrees, much of the early vegetation in this locality was believed frost bitten this morning.
